The Bordeaux wine region of France has always attracted international investment. As the Asian economy developed, individuals and beverage companies looked abroad to diversify their portfolios. In the mid 1980’s, Japanese investors like Suntory started to buy Estates in Bordeaux. Over the past decade, it’s estimated that close to 160 Chateaux’s have shifted hands to Hong Kong and Mainland Chinese investors. In this two part podcast series we’ll be diving into China’s largest wine producing region: Shandong. Shandong is an eastern province of China, along the Yellow Sea. It represents up to 40% of China’s wine production and was also home to the first commercial winery. Our guest today is Denise Cosentino.
